Transaction 074d2230181cf4df0ea004d84274d15d07c03150078a8468f2d69f5911b2368c

1 Input
2 Outputs
  • 074d2230181cf4df0ea004d84274d15d07c03150078a8468f2d69f5911b2368c:0
  • value  3320487
    address  3Fp2jnGmPeF9q8E8aKvKqVhFeazvS41AvC
  • 074d2230181cf4df0ea004d84274d15d07c03150078a8468f2d69f5911b2368c:1
  • value  4133373
    address  163gEeNPAthWFRBUxEVabEaDR8xHwiRuZw